- The distance between Burgeo, Nf, Canada and Agadir, Morocco is approximately 3,791 km or 2,356 mi.
- To reach Burgeo, Nf in this distance one would set out from Agadir bearing 297.6°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Burgeo, Nf bearing 273.5° or W .
- Burgeo, Nf has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c) whereas Agadir has a subtropical hot steppe climate (BSh).
- The annual mean temperature is 14.2 °C (25.6°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 12.3 °C (22.1°F) more in Burgeo, Nf.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1447.3 mm (57 in) more which is equivalent to 1447.3 l/m² (35.52 US gal/ft²) or 14,473,000 l/ha (1,547,260 US gal/ac) more. About 6 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 9.6° lower in Burgeo, Nf than in Agadir.
